[PATCH 0/2] Dynamic Tick: Enabling longer sleep times on 32-bit machines

From: Jon Hunter
Date: Wed May 27 2009 - 10:49:07 EST



This patch series ensures that the wrapping of the clocksource will not be missed if the kernel sleeps for longer periods and allows 32-bit machines to sleep for longer than 2.15 seconds.

Jon Hunter (2):
Dynamic Tick: Prevent clocksource wrapping during idle
Dynamic Tick: Allow 32-bit machines to sleep for more than 2.15
seconds
